New Delhi, Jan. 12 -- The Caribbean island nation of Cuba, which is a little smaller than the State of Pennsylvania in the United States, located in the Atlantic Ocean, is now under US President Donald Trump's radar after he launched a 'large-scale' attack on the South American nation of Venezuela and arrested President Nicolas Maduro. America's interest in Cuba is much more than just the geographical reasoning; it's borderline strategic.
Soon after the turn of the year into 2026, Donald Trump carried out military strikes on Venezuela and captured Maduro amid allegations about the leader turning the country into a "narco-state" and manipulating elections.
